Is Tuscany a city in Italy?

December 14, 2021 by Sadie Daniel

Tuscany, Italian Toscana, regione (region), west-central Italy. It lies along the Tyrrhenian and Ligurian seas and comprises the province (provinces) of Massa-Carrara, Lucca, Pistoia, Prato, Firenze, Livorno, Pisa, Arezzo, Siena, and Grosseto. Tuscan countryside, Monteriggioni, Italy.

Is Tuscany a city or region?

Tuscany (/ˈtʌskəni/ TUSK-ə-nee; Italian: Toscana [tosˈkaːna]) is a region in central Italy with an area of about 23,000 square kilometres (8,900 square miles) and a population of about 3.8 million inhabitants. The regional capital is Florence (Firenze).

Is it expensive to live in Tuscany?

As a region, Tuscany is one of the more expensive places to live in Italy. This is because of its association with tourism. However, the cost of living in Tuscany is still fairly low, and house prices are attractive.Florence, the region’s capital, is the most expensive place to live in Tuscany.

Is Tuscany on the coast?

Tuscany has a long coast (230 kilometres) with a lot of variety.Castiglioncello is a pretty resort in a rocky coastal area, while the Etruscan coast boasts long sandy beaches, both free or with bathing establishments.
